> I am fairly new to the pc world. I need direction on some questions I
have. My first question is with Outlook Express. If you are using this, is
there a way to scrammble all your temp files, cookies, instant messaging,
and all other related internet usage?
Cookies are stored in the Cookies folder. No scrambling is done there.
The Temporary Internet Files folder has a unique name that is unique to your
computer. No need to scamble there.
Temp files are not scrambled as well.
Best thing to do is get something like Windows Washer and let it delete
those files for you.
>My second question does Outlook look or scan for programs that track and
monitor your activity? Like pcbloodhound. Thanks
No. It's just a mail and news client only.
